    UAE Thwarts Major Iranian Missile and Drone Assault, Reports Three Fatalities

    The United Arab Emirates recently faced a significant aerial assault involving missiles and drones launched by Iran, which the country’s defence forces largely managed to neutralize. In a detailed statement, the UAE Ministry of Defence revealed that Iran had targeted the nation with a total of 186 missiles. Thanks to the advanced air defence systems in place, 172 of these missiles were successfully intercepted before they could cause widespread destruction.

    In addition to the missile barrage, the UAE also encountered a massive drone offensive. Authorities detected 812 Iranian drones entering the country’s airspace, out of which 755 were destroyed by the UAE’s defence forces. This large-scale interception effort highlights the intensity and complexity of the attack, which tested the resilience and readiness of the nation’s military capabilities.

    Despite the impressive defensive measures, the missile strikes did result in tragic consequences. The Ministry of Defence confirmed that three individuals lost their lives, and 68 others sustained injuries. Furthermore, several civilian neighborhoods experienced property damage, underscoring the human and material cost of the assault. These casualties have prompted the UAE government to expedite emergency response protocols across the country to provide aid and ensure public safety.

    Officials emphasized that the UAE maintains ample defensive resources and stockpiles to continue countering missile and drone threats over an extended period. The Ministry of Defence described the successful interceptions as a clear demonstration of the nation’s robust military strength. Given that such aerial threats are notoriously difficult to detect and neutralize, the effective response underscores the high level of preparedness and technological sophistication of the UAE’s armed forces.

    During a recent press briefing, Emirati officials showcased fragments of the intercepted missiles as tangible evidence of their successful defensive operations. The spokesperson reiterated the country’s firm stance on safeguarding its sovereignty, affirming that the UAE will persistently defend its territory against any form of aggression. This incident has further solidified the government’s commitment to protecting its citizens and infrastructure from external threats.

    At the same time, the UAE has called for a reduction in regional tensions, advocating for peaceful dialogue over military confrontation. The defence ministry stressed that the nation does not seek to escalate the conflict and believes that diplomatic engagement remains the most viable path to resolving ongoing disputes. This balanced approach reflects the UAE’s desire to maintain stability in a volatile region while ensuring its security interests are uncompromised.
